## Authentication

Quick notes for the sync: the GiftNote receipt mailer talks to the Almsbridge API over HTTPS, and every send call needs a bearer token in the Authorization header. Tokens rotate weekly, so don't hardcode them — pull from the env var at startup. If you get a 401, it's almost always a stale token, not a bug. For local testing against the sandbox, grab config from the shared vault and use the token below.

bearer token for yagep-faweg: eyJhbGciOiJIUzI1NiIsInR5cCI6IkpXVCJ9.eyJzdWIiOiI60rWz9In0.3hPJo82S

## Changelog — Ticktrace 1.9

### Renamed: DRIFT_API_TOKEN
During the cron drift investigation we found plugins confusing this variable with the metrics token, so it has been renamed to indicate it authorizes drift-report uploads specifically. Plugin authors must read the new name from 1.9 onward; the old name is ignored without warning. Sample env files in the SDK are updated. In your deployment env file, the drift-report upload secret is set on the next line.

env line for fawef-taguf: VAULT_KEY13=a9695905a9a90

Marta Hellings presented the valuation range and confirmed due diligence by the prospective buyer, Drayfold Capital, is nearly complete. Branch managers should note: staffing at Kelsmere sites remains unchanged until completion, and no external communication is authorised. Customer accounts tied to Kelsmere will be reassigned per the transition schedule circulated last week. Questions go through regional directors only. The rationale and forward plan are summarised below.

internal memo for kawip-hadug: Headcount on the Wenwyn team goes from 7 to 140 by the end of January. Gross margin on Wenwyn came in at 20 percent against a plan of 15 percent.

**Q: Has the color-contrast audit for the Brightfall dashboard been completed?**

A: Yes. The Pellworth accessibility team finished the audit last sprint; all remaining contrast issues are tracked as release blockers until resolved. Check the status of each finding before approving a build. The full audit report lives here:

wiki page, fahif-bawep: https://jira.tolvaqsys.internal/browse/projects/projects/67caf315